Comparative Efficacy Of Exenatide In Different Times Of Injection In The Treatment Of Type 2 Diabetes

Background:Currently, the industry for the study of type 2 diabetes becomes deeper and deeper. In 2008 Derronzo professor put forward the famous response type 2 diabetes pathophysiology change theory. He pointed out that besides the islet β-cell function damage, output increased liver glycogen, peripheral tissues to insulin produced resistance to the three known defects, many with glucose metabolism related organizations and organs also participated in the occurrence and development of type 2 diabetes, including the decomposition of fat increased, incretin hormone weakened, islet α-cell secretion of glucagon, increased after renal reabsorption of glucose, central nervous system neurotransmitter function appear obstacles. This for the treatment of type 2 diabetes mellitus presents significant challenges, the industry’s urgent need for a comprehensive consideration of different risk factors of drug, glucagon-like peptide-1(GLP-1) analogues arises at the historic moment. Exenatide as the first approved GLP-1 analogues, both have excellent hypoglycemic ability and balance weight loss, regulating blood fat, improve insulin resistance, lower blood pressure, the advantages, application prospect is very gratifying. Along with the deepening of the clinical research, exenatide in glycemic control research data has become increasingly rich, traditional twice a day of injection can effective control the blood glucose after breakfast and dinner, but the study found the for postprandial blood glucose control effect is weak, and long-acting GLP-1 analogues of ratio, use of exenatide treatment of patients more prone to blood glucose fluctuations. By exenatide plug of the peptide pharmacokinetics characteristics shows that, the half-life of 2.4h, twice injection one day is the reason for lunch after the glucose effect may be weak and has a short half-life, drug concentration maintained a steady ability is weak. In theory, small dose multiple injections is to maintain the body of drug concentration at steady state in the best way, but the reported very little.Objective:This study in overweight type 2 diabetic population as the research object, were given different doses and the number of injections of exenatide, plug the peptide in the treatment of 6 months were observed compared the biochemical index changes, for patients with type 2 diabetes using exenatide provide more suitable treatment.Methods:The study included a total of 23 subjects, both in the Southwest Hospital Endocrinology and Metabolic diseases of type 2 diabetes mellitus(T2DM). To the detailed description of the purpose, process and the specific methods of operation and signed informed consent into the group, according to the random number table method is divided into two needle group(exenatide 10 ug 2 times a day) and three- needle group(exenatide 5ug 3 times a day). After 1 weeks of drug delivery period(exenatide 5ug 1 times a day) starting of observation for 6 months.At the time of the subject to observe collected their gender, age, height(H), body weight(W), body mass index(BMI), whether complicated with hypertension or hyperlipidemia, combined with oral hypoglycemic agents or insulin, the statistical correlation analysis.In this study, a total of 2 times followed up. The follow-up time respectively after 1 week of small doses of the drug import and completed 6 months of treatment period. Every follow-up were collected following observation indexes: height(H), body weight(W), body mass index(BMI), waist circumference(W)(H), hip circumference, waist hip ratio(W/H), fasting blood glucose(FPG), 2 hour postprandial blood glucose(2hPG), fasting, postprandial C peptide 2 hours C peptide, glycosylated hemoglobin(HbA1C), total cholesterol(Tch), triglyceride(TG), low density lipoprotein cholesterol(LDL-C), high density lipoprotein cholesterol(HDL-C), alanine aminotransferase(ALT), aspartate aminotransferase(AST), serum creatinine(Cr), urea nitrogen(UN), three days before the follow-up of fasting blood glucose, blood glucose after meals early in the evening, before going to bed at 2 in the morning the night of blood glucose and blood glucose self-monitoring of blood glucose(SMBG), statistical analysis of the above indexes.Monthly telephone follow-up time, record the patient’s W, BMI, W, h, SMBG and adverse reactions, adverse reactions mainly includes fatigue sweating, general discomfort, nausea, vomiting and other gastrointestinal reactions, dizziness, headache, nervous system discomfort, acute pancreatitis, acute liver dysfunction, acute renal damage.Results:1.During the period of 1 week of small dose drug delivery period, 3 patients due to severe gastrointestinal reaction cannot tolerate out of this study, of which two needle group(n = 2), three needle group(n = 1), the remaining 20 cases with good compliance to at the end of observation No 1 cases lost to follow-up.2.Two acupuncture group and acupuncture group of patients after 6 months of AI plug the peptide after treatment, the W, W, w / h, FPG, PPG, HbA1 c, TCH, TG, LDL-C were compared with those before treatment declined, high-density lipoprotein cholesterol(HDL-C), fasting C peptide and postprandial 2 hour C peptide increased, but after a between group comparison, the difference of the two no statistical significance(P > 0.05), BMI in the two groups of patients after treatment than before treatment significantly decreased, the three needles group BMI decreased compared with two needle group was significantly, and the difference has statistical significance(P < 0.05);3.Two acupuncture group and acupuncture group of patients after 6 months of AI plug the peptide after treatment, compared with before treatment, SMBG was significantly decreased, the blood sugar(12.56 + 1.32mmol/L) three needles group patients after lunch, bedtime blood glucose(8.97 + 1.07mmol/L) than those of the other two needle group lunch after blood glucose(13.25 + 1.23mmol/L), sleep of blood glucose(9.78 + 0.70mmol/L) lower, and the difference has statistical significance(P < 0.05).Conclusion:1.Exenatide 5ug three times a day of injection and 10 ug twice a day of injection compared to more conducive to control the blood glucose after lunch.2.Exenatide 5ug a day three times injection can also get effective improvement and control in patients with type 2 diabetes high blood glucose, disorder of lipid metabolism and body mass.
